Is the Toronto concert part of a bigger tour?
Yes, the Massey Hall show is one stop on the Juanes North America Tour 2026, which is itself an important part of the global Juanes World Tour 2026. The North American leg begins in Orlando on September 3, moves through several U.S. cities, and crosses into Canada for Toronto on September 19 and Montreal on September 22 before returning to U.S. dates like Boston, Rosemont, and Omaha. This run has been described as Juanes’s most ambitious North American itinerary yet, blending major arenas with legendary theaters such as Massey Hall for a mix of big energy and intimate experiences.

Where is Massey Hall located and how do I get there?
Massey Hall is located at 178 Victoria Street in downtown Toronto, just east of Yonge Street and a short walk from major intersections like Yonge–Dundas Square. It is easily accessible by public transit, with nearby TTC subway stations (such as Queen and Dundas) and multiple streetcar and bus routes running through the area. If you are driving, there are several public parking garages and lots within walking distance, but downtown traffic and event-night congestion mean you should allow extra time to park and walk to the venue.
What is the seating and capacity like at Massey Hall for this concert?
Massey Hall is a historic, multi-level theater with orchestra, balcony, and upper-gallery seating, designed for concerts and performances with excellent sightlines and acoustics. It seats roughly 2,500 people, making it much smaller than an arena and giving the show a more personal, up-close feel even from seats further back.
